ADDISON ELEMENTARY SCHOOL

Addison Elementary is a public school located in Hartford, Wisconsin, serving as part of the Slinger School District. Situated in a rural setting on Indian Road, the school focuses on providing a foundational education for students in the elementary grade levels. It benefits from the resources and organizational support of the broader Slinger district, which is well-regarded for its commitment to academic achievement and community-centered schooling.

The school emphasizes a supportive learning environment designed to foster both intellectual and social-emotional growth in young learners. By maintaining strong communication with families and utilizing the district’s established curriculum, Addison Elementary aims to prepare its students for a successful transition to middle school. * A public charter school is a publicly funded school that is typically governed by a group or organization under a legislative contract with the state, the district, or another entity. The charter exempts the school from certain state or local rules and regulations.

1 The National School Lunch Program (NSLP) provides eligible students with free or reduced-price lunch

2 Title I, Part A (Title I) of the Elementary and Secondary Education Act provides supplemental financial assistance to school districts for children from low-income families.
